Sat 1502781502144587

decimal
391112.1502144587
degree
0°181112′8″1502144587‴
percentile
71.56102399036416%
name
deyvpwdsrza
cycle
0
epoch
1
period
194
block
391112
offset
1502144587
timestamp
rarity
common